黔北務(wù)正道地區(qū)沉積型鋁土礦床層序地層學(xué)

摘 要: 對(duì)黔北務(wù)正道地區(qū)鋁土礦進(jìn)行層序地層學(xué)分析有利于認(rèn)識(shí)鋁土礦分布規(guī)律和形成機(jī)理,可有效解指導(dǎo)將來鋁土礦勘探。通過探槽和取心井巖心觀察以及鋁土礦含礦層系樣品分析化驗(yàn)資料分析認(rèn)為,研究區(qū)梁山組鋁土礦含礦層系為海相和陸相環(huán)境沉積,其沉積相類型包括沖積扇、瀉湖、湖泊和沼澤。鋁土礦含礦層系可劃分為3個(gè)Ⅰ型層序界面,識(shí)別出3個(gè)三級(jí)層序。每個(gè)層序下部的綠泥石巖和鋁土巖為海侵體系域沉積,而層序上部的鋁土礦則為湖泊相沉積。從含礦層系到棲霞組底部整體為海平面不斷上升,沉積相類型也由含礦層系的海相和陸相互層過渡為海相碳酸鹽巖沉積。海侵體系域沉積期跨時(shí)較短,易于形成沖積扇和瀉湖等沉積,巖石類型包括綠泥石巖和鋁土巖,而高位體系域跨時(shí)較長(zhǎng),綠泥石巖、鋁土巖及其風(fēng)化物能夠進(jìn)行充分的沉積分異作用,從而形成鋁土礦,因此,層序格架對(duì)鋁土礦的形成具有控制作用。

 

關(guān)鍵字: 沉積型鋁土礦;層序地層學(xué);湖泊相;沉積分異;基準(zhǔn)面

Sequence stratigraphy of bauxite deposition in Wuzhengdao area in Qianbei, North Guizhou

Abstract:Bauxite distribution law and formation mechanism can be known by sequence stratigraphy analyses of bauxite in Wuzhengdao area, North Guizhou, which can guide exploration of bauxite ore. Based on observation of exploratory trench, cores well and results of sample test, it can be gotten that the main facies of bauxite are marine and continental sedimentary environment, including alluvial fan, lagoon, lake and marsh. Three sequence boundaries of type Ⅰcan be identified, and three sequences can be divided. Chlorite rock and bauxite rock under every sequence deposit in transgressive system tract and bauxite ore upper every sequence deposits in lake. The marine level rises from ore-bearing layer to bottom of Qixia formation (P2q) on the whole, and the facies change from marine and continental facies to marine facies correspondingly. The time is short during deposit of transgressive system tract, and alluvial fan and lagoon develop well. The rock types of transgressive system tract include chlorite and bauxite rock. The time is long during deposit of highstand system tract, and the sedimentary differentiation of chlorite, bauxite rock and its weathered material is carried out fully, which result in forming bauxite ore. So the sequence framework can control the forming of bauxite ore.

 

Key words: sedimentary type bauxite ore; sequence stratigraphy; lacustrine facies; sedimentary differentiation; base level
